Preventing the Common Cold
Filed under General Health
When you would like to keep healthy, everybody understands how important it is to get enough Vitamin C. People are informed again and again how useful Vitamin C is to staying healthy. When you get the flu, what’s the first thing folks say to you? “Eat some Vitamin C!” Now, though, there has been some small amount of speculation with regards to whether or not Vitamin C is actually beneficial in preventing the common cold.
By now you have no doubt also been advised about Echinacea. The idea is that, if you take an Echinacea product as soon as you feel a cold setting in, you can keep it from really grabbing hold of you. Just lately, however, studies have verified that Echinacea provides little more than a placebo effect for those suffering from cold and flu symtoms. At most the supplement cuts the cold’s length by twenty hours. It isn’t some sort of cure.
So just what do you do to hold the colds away? Here are some tips to actually give you a hand.
1. Clean your hands. Clean the hands a whole lot. This is definitely about the simplest that you can keep a cold from setting in. Why does this method work as well as it does? Think over it for just a minute. Your hands will get contact with flu and cold microbes than any other part of your body. Did you ever look at all the material you touch each day? You increase your odds of coming down with something whenever you touch anything that has already been touched by someone suffering from a cold or the flu. If you wash your hands a lot, you will be far less likely to let any of the microbes that you have made contact with get into your system and grab hold.
2. Get a lot of rest. Staying up late can be very tempting, particularly when your life is tense. Maybe you need to complete much more. Perhaps you would like to see your friends more often. Maybe there is a television show you’ve been waiting around to catch. All these things decrease the amount of sleep that you are able to get. You will need to give your system enough rest so that it will have the vitality to fight off any infections that want to set in. It is when you’re sleeping and resting that your body is able to do the maintenance and repairs that you need to do. The more sleep you get, the easier a time your system will have warding off an infection and then getting rid of it if it happens to take hold of you anyway.
3. Drink a lot of water. In order to stay alive, you need to take in a minimum of sixty four ounces of water every day. Your body demands the hydration to help it eliminate the waste that have taken up residence in your system. If you do not get the correct hydration, germs hang out inside of you instead of being flushed out. Don’t forget: your body can last about 7 days without eating solid food. Your body can only last a couple of days if you don’t stay hydrated. This on it’s own ought to make you recognise just how important proper hydration is.
Here’s the thing: there is no mysterious solution for the flu. All you have is your individual common sense and correct preventative procedures like keeping clean, resting a lot and drinking a good amount of water.
